北瀚科技
繁體中文 简体中文 English
星期四, 2012 二月 23
会员登录
产品介绍
谁在在线
现在有 3 访客 在线
VeriSoC-CA8

 

Overview


     The SMIMS VeriSoC® is an embedded system with FPGA. It supports software and hardware co-design and co-verification. In the software side, VeriSoC® uses Android OS and provides JAVA API to develop software applications for communicating with the FPGA device. In the hardware side, VeriSoC® uses memory mapping to connect ARM CPU and the FPGA device.

The SMIMS VeriSoC® also provides an emulator in a Windows PC and it simulates the embedded system. The emulator connects to the FPGA through the USB port of PC. In the emulator, the same JAVA API used to develop software applications for communicating with the FPGA device.

 

Key Features

  • Support Android 2.2 Java development API.
  • Link the Android® SDK emulator with SMIMS® FPGA Platforms in Windows PC.
  • Support SMIMS-CA8 board with SMIMS® FPGA Platforms.
  • Support the same Android JAVA application (APK) for emulator and the real hardware (SMIMS-CA8).
  • Support Eclipse® to develop Android JAVA application.

Specification:

  • SMIMS VeriSoC tools:
    • Android Emulator with SMIMS VeriEnterprise S150: Provide an Android emulator on Windows PC which may co-work with SMIMS FPGA VeriEnterprise S150. development Platform.
    • VeriSoC Java API: Using Java API to communicate with SMIMS FPGA VeriEnterprise S150 development Platform.
    • VeriEnterprise S150 Device Driver: Provide drivers for the different OS of Windows XP/Vista32 on PC, Android 2.2 on Emulator, and Android 2.2 on SMIMS-CA8 Board.
  • Support 3rd-party development tools:
    • Android SDK: android-sdk_r04-windows with platforms android-2.2
      JDK: version 5 or 6 for windows
    • Eclipse: version 3.4 or 3.5, needed only if you want develop using the ADT Plug-in.
    • Android Development Tools (ADT) : version 0.9.5
    • Android Platforms: version 2.2
    • Xilinx ISE: version 11.1 or later
  • SMIMS-CA8 
    • CPU: Samsung S5PC100 Cortex-A8  800MHz
    • RAM: Samsung mDDR 256 MByte
    • Flash: NAND flash 256 MByte
    • LCD: 7" LCD WVGA 800x480 with 4-wire touch panel
    • 10/100 base ethernet
    • 1 DB9 RS-232, 2 TTL UART
    • 1 MIni-usb slave-OTG-2.0
    • 1 USB 1.1 Host
    • VGA, HDMI output
    • SD
    • Mic/Line in, Headset/Line out
    • EBI
  • SMIMS VeriEnterprise S150
    • FPGA: Xilinx Spartan-6 XC6SLX150
    • FPGA Program: Download FPGA configuration through USB (PC or SMIMS-CA8) or JTAG
    • GIO Pin: Up to 236 additional available I/Os with selectable IO Voltages (3.3V or 2.5V)
    • User Outputs: 8 user-defined LEDs
    • User Inputs: 2 user-defined push buttons, 2 user-defined dip switch
    • USB: mini USB x 1, USB 2.0 interface
    • Power: Powered through USB +5V, Power switch
    • LED: 2 indicator LEDs
    • Expansion: Connected to System Bus of SMIMS-CA8 Board
    • OS Support:
      • Connect to PC: Android Emulator on Windows PC
      • Connect to SMIMS-CA8: Android and Linux
  • Verification Software – VeriComm with HDL Ximulation:
         VeriComm is an easy-to-use verification environment which allows easy and quick debugging/analysis for a HDL-based circuit on SMIMS FPGA Platform. HDL Ximulation allows you to view FPGA internal signals or nodes in the Vericomm. A tree view GUI is offered for internal signal selection. With the help of internal signal debugger, the verification time for a user’s circuit can be reduced up to 50%.
    • Input format
      • ASCII Text import
      • Testbench import
      • VCD dump import
      • Waveform editor
      • Audio import from Microphone
      • Video/Image import from Webcam
    • Waveform Display
      • Zoom in/Zoom out/Zoom all
      • Search by edge/value
      • Bookmark
      • Group a bus
    • Output waveform to ASCII Text file
    • HDL Ximulation
      • Up to 1024 internal signals observation
      • RTL level
      • Internal signal selection GUI
  • PROVIDE

 
 
Copyright © 2008 SMIMS Technology Corp. All Rights Reserved.
We create Smart, Multiple, Integrated, Media Systems